Bright, Stylish, And Distinctly Modern, Tucked Away On A Quiet Laneway Just Moments From Bloor Street. Welcome To 50 Bartlett Ave. Thoughtfully Designed To Maximize Space And Light, The Home Is Cascading With Natural Light Throughout, Creating An Airy And Inviting Atmosphere Across Every Level. The Main Floor Offers A Spacious, Open-Concept Layout Featuring A Large Custom Kitchen With Quality Finishes, Heated Stone Floors, And A Dramatic Living Room With Soaring 18-Foot Ceilings. Expansive Windows Enhance The Sense Of Volume And Brightness, While A Discreetly Positioned Powder Room Adds Convenience Without Compromising The Clean Design. Upstairs, The Full-Floor Primary Suite Serves As A Private Retreat, Complete With A Luxurious Ensuite Bathroom And Generous Proportions. The Third Level Provides An Additional Bedroom, Abundant Storage, And Flexible Space For A Home Office Or Guest Area. Topping It All Off Is A Private Rooftop Terrace-Perfect For Relaxing Or Entertaining-Offering A Rare Outdoor Escape In This Architecturally Striking, Light-Filled Urban Home.

Who lives here?

Dovercourt Park, Toronto is a central Toronto neighbourhood notable for its singles, renters, university grads, education, law & public sector and arts & culture professionals, salespeople and tradespeople. It has a higher than average population of immigrants from Portugal, and Portuguese speakers. Residents tend to be younger with a significant number of adults aged 25 to 44.
